Oscillatory Phase Behaviour as a Function of Film Thickness due to Confinement in fcc (100) AsB Alloy Thin Films

摘要:
The order-disorder phase transitions in fcc thin films are investigated by using the mean field method. The result shows that there is a significant difference in the phase transitions and surface segregation between the films of even-number and odd-number layers. There are various types of phase transitions involving several ordered phases with spatial variation for the film of even-number layers, while there is only one phase transition for the film of odd-number layers.
